http://www.urbandictionary.com/define.php?term=tasha
| 1st meaning: lookin good, very stunning and always glowing a tasha is a beautiful creature who gets alot of unknown attention example: shes as beautiful as a tasha |
2nd meaning:
| One pill of extasy of the narcotic variety. example: Dude, let me drop that tasha. | ||
3rd meaning:
a sexy person/thing named tasha who enjoys eeting toes and licking the windows

No comments:
Post a Comment